The Power of Big Data in Business Decision-Making

Big data has become an indispensable asset for businesses seeking to make informed decisions. By analyzing vast amounts of data, organizations can uncover hidden patterns, trends, and insights that would otherwise remain obscured. This data-driven approach empowers businesses to understand customer behavior, optimize operations, identify new market opportunities, and anticipate future trends. The insights derived from big data analysis can be applied to various aspects of business, from marketing and sales to supply chain management and risk assessment.

Applications of Big Data in Business

The applications of big data in business are vast and diverse, spanning across multiple domains. In marketing, big data enables businesses to personalize customer experiences, target specific demographics, and optimize marketing campaigns for maximum impact. By analyzing customer data, businesses can tailor their marketing messages, product recommendations, and promotions to individual preferences, leading to increased customer engagement and loyalty.

In operations, big data plays a crucial role in optimizing processes, reducing costs, and improving efficiency. By analyzing data from various sources, such as production lines, supply chains, and customer interactions, businesses can identify bottlenecks, streamline workflows, and optimize resource allocation. This data-driven approach can lead to significant improvements in productivity, cost savings, and overall operational efficiency.

The Benefits of Implementing Big Data

Implementing big data in business decision-making offers numerous benefits, including:

* Enhanced Customer Understanding: Big data provides a comprehensive view of customer behavior, preferences, and needs, enabling businesses to tailor their products, services, and marketing efforts to individual customers.

* Improved Operational Efficiency: By analyzing data from various sources, businesses can identify areas for improvement, optimize processes, and streamline operations, leading to increased productivity and cost savings.

* New Product and Service Development: Big data analysis can reveal emerging trends and customer needs, enabling businesses to develop innovative products and services that meet market demands.

* Competitive Advantage: Businesses that leverage big data effectively gain a competitive advantage by making data-driven decisions, optimizing operations, and anticipating market trends.

Challenges of Implementing Big Data

While big data offers significant opportunities, implementing it effectively presents certain challenges:

* Data Storage and Management: Handling massive volumes of data requires robust storage and management infrastructure, which can be costly and complex.

* Data Security and Privacy: Protecting sensitive customer data is paramount, and businesses must implement strong security measures to prevent data breaches and comply with privacy regulations.

* Data Analysis and Interpretation: Extracting meaningful insights from vast amounts of data requires specialized skills and tools, and businesses need to invest in data scientists and analysts.

* Integration with Existing Systems: Integrating big data systems with existing business processes and applications can be challenging, requiring careful planning and execution.
